Cavalry \Cav"al*ry\, n. [F. cavalerie, fr. It. cavalleria. See
   Cavalier, and cf. chivalry.] (Mil.)
   That part of military force which serves on horseback.
   [1913 Webster]
   Note: Heavy cavalry and light cavalry are so
         distinguished by the character of their armament, and
         by the size of the men and horses.
